Understanding the Security Infrastructure of Online Casinos
Security in the online casino world doesn't simply mean protecting against hackers; it’s a multifaceted approach encompassing data encryption, fraud prevention, and responsible gaming measures. Reputable platforms employ sophisticated encryption technologies, such as Secure Socket Layer (SSL) and Transport Layer Security (TLS), to safeguard sensitive data transmission. This ensures that information exchanged between the player’s device and the casino’s servers is unreadable to unauthorized parties. Furthermore, they implement robust firewalls and intrusion detection systems to prevent unauthorized access to their systems. Beyond the technical aspects, rigorous identity verification processes are in place to prevent fraudulent activity, such as money laundering and underage gambling. These often involve verifying identification documents and conducting checks against various databases.
The Role of Licensing and Regulation
Licensing and regulation play a critical role in upholding security standards. Casinos operating legally are typically licensed by reputable regulatory bodies, such as the Malta Gaming Authority, the UK Gambling Commission, or the Curacao eGaming. These bodies impose strict requirements regarding security protocols, fair game play, and responsible gambling practices. A valid license demonstrates that the casino has been vetted and meets certain standards of operation, providing players with a degree of assurance. Independent auditing firms regularly assess these casinos to ensure ongoing compliance with regulations. These audits verify the fairness of random number generators (RNGs) used in games, ensuring that outcomes are truly random and not manipulated.
| Regulatory Body | Jurisdiction | Key Responsibilities |
|---|---|---|
| Malta Gaming Authority (MGA) | Malta | Licensing, regulation, and oversight of all forms of gaming in Malta. |
| UK Gambling Commission (UKGC) | United Kingdom | Regulates all gambling activities in Great Britain, ensuring fairness and protecting vulnerable individuals. |
| Curacao eGaming | Curacao | Issues licenses to online gaming operators, offering a more streamlined regulatory process. |
Choosing a casino with a respected license is a crucial step in ensuring a safe and fair gaming experience. Players should always verify the licensing information before depositing any funds.

Compliance with GDPR and Other Data Privacy Laws
Compliance with data privacy laws is not only a legal requirement but also a matter of ethical responsibility. Casinos must obtain explicit consent from players before collecting and using their personal data. They must also provide players with the right to access, rectify, and erase their data. Implementing robust data security measures, such as data encryption and access controls, is essential for protecting personal information from unauthorized access. Regular security audits and vulnerability assessments can help identify and address potential security weaknesses. Transparency is also key. Casinos should clearly explain their data privacy policies and how they collect, use, and protect personal information.

Responsible Gaming and Player Protection
Beyond security and convenience, responsible gaming is a vital aspect of any reputable online casino. Platforms have a duty to protect vulnerable players and promote responsible gambling habits. This includes offering tools and resources to help players control their gambling behavior, such as deposit limits, self-exclusion options, and time limits. Deposit limits allow players to set a maximum amount of money they can deposit into their account within a specific period. Self-exclusion allows players to voluntarily ban themselves from the casino for a set period. Time limits remind players how long they have been playing and encourage them to take breaks.
